.form-reservas-asdon-admin{width:300px;max-width:100%}table.listaactividades{width:100%;padding:10px}table.listaactividades tr:nth-child(odd){background-color:#ccc}table.listaactividades td,table.listaactividades th{padding:1em}.mensaje_informativo{text-align:center;width:100%;padding:2em;border:1px solid #ccc;border-radius:5px;font-weight:700}.mensaje_informativo.ok{color:green}.asdonCard{width:100%;padding:1em 2em;border:1px solid #ccc;border-radius:5px}.asdonCard .card-title{font-weight:700;font-size:1.2em}.asdonRow{display:flex;flex-wrap:wrap;gap:2%}.asdonRow>div{width:100%;margin-bottom:1em}@media screen and (min-width:769px){.asdonRow>div{width:49%}}.asdonRow label{font-weight:700;display:block;font-size:1rem}.asdonSelect,.asdonText{padding:.5em 0;font-size:1rem;width:100%;border:1px solid rgba(0,0,0,.42)}.asdonSubmit{padding:.5em 1em;margin-top:1em}.gj-datepicker-md [role=right-icon]{top:6px}td.current-month.gj-cursor-pointer{font-weight:700;color:green}@media screen and (max-width:600px){.gj-picker,.gj-picker table{max-width:400px!important}.gj-picker table td,.gj-picker table th{padding:7px!important}.gj-picker-md table tr td div,.gj-picker-md table tr th div{width:20px!important;height:20px!important;line-height:20px!important}}